The Associated Press is reporting that the Los Angeles Dodgers are near a trade for Nats ace Max Scherzer and All-Star shortstop Trea Turner.
The Nationals would get four young players for Washington’s dynamic duo.
Scherzer has been given permission to speak to the Dodgers to see if he will waive his right to veto any trade, a power he has as a 10-year veteran who has been with his team for at least five years.
If the trade goes through, it would be a stunning haul for the Dodgers, who are three games behind NL West-leading San Francisco. Los Angeles owns the top spot in the wild-card race, 2 1/2 games ahead of San Diego.
With the Major League Baseball trade deadline at 4 p.m. EDT today, there was speculation that the Padres would be the winners in the Scherzer sweepstakes.
